#include "ConditionAssignments.h"
#include "ConditionsStore.h"
#include "DataNode.h"
#include "DataWriter.h"
#include <algorithm>
#include <numeric>
using namespace std;
namespace {
const auto ASSIGN_OP_TO_TEXT = map<ConditionAssignments::AssignOp, const string> {
{ConditionAssignments::AssignOp::ASSIGN, "="},
{ConditionAssignments::AssignOp::ADD, "+="},
{ConditionAssignments::AssignOp::SUB, "-="},
{ConditionAssignments::AssignOp::MUL, "*="},
{ConditionAssignments::AssignOp::DIV, "/="},
{ConditionAssignments::AssignOp::LT, "<?="},
{ConditionAssignments::AssignOp::GT, ">?="},
};
}
// Construct and Load() at the same time.
ConditionAssignments::ConditionAssignments(const DataNode &node, const ConditionsStore *conditions)
{
Load(node, conditions);
}
// Load a set of conditions from the children of this node.
void ConditionAssignments::Load(const DataNode &node, const ConditionsStore *conditions)
{
this->conditions = conditions;
if(!node.HasChildren())
node.PrintTrace("Error: Loading empty set of assignments");
// Loop through all children, and parse each line into an Assignment.
for(const DataNode &child : node)
Add(child, conditions);
}
// Save a set of conditions.
void ConditionAssignments::Save(DataWriter &out) const
{
for(const Assignment &assignment : assignments)
{
AssignOp aso = assignment.assignOperator;
auto it = ASSIGN_OP_TO_TEXT.find(aso);
if(it != ASSIGN_OP_TO_TEXT.end())
{
out.WriteToken(assignment.conditionToAssignTo);
out.WriteToken(it->second);
assignment.expressionToEvaluate.SaveSubset(out);
out.Write();
}
}
}
// Check if there are any entries in this set.
bool ConditionAssignments::IsEmpty() const
{
return assignments.empty();
}
void ConditionAssignments::Apply() const
{
if(IsEmpty())
return;
if(!conditions)
throw runtime_error("Unable to Apply ConditionAssignments without a pointer to a ConditionsStore!");
ConditionsStore &conditionsStore = *const_cast<ConditionsStore *>(conditions);
for(const Assignment &assignment : assignments)
{
auto &ce = conditionsStore[assignment.conditionToAssignTo];
int64_t newValue = assignment.expressionToEvaluate.Evaluate();
switch(assignment.assignOperator)
{
case AssignOp::ASSIGN:
ce = newValue;
break;
case AssignOp::ADD:
ce += newValue;
break;
case AssignOp::SUB:
ce -= newValue;
break;
case AssignOp::MUL:
ce = static_cast<int64_t>(ce) * newValue;
break;
case AssignOp::DIV:
ce = newValue ? static_cast<int64_t>(ce) / newValue : numeric_limits<int64_t>::max();
break;
case AssignOp::LT:
ce = min(static_cast<int64_t>(ce), newValue);
break;
case AssignOp::GT:
ce = max(static_cast<int64_t>(ce), newValue);
break;
}
}
}
set<string> ConditionAssignments::RelevantConditions() const
{
set<string> result;
for(const Assignment &assignment : assignments)
{
result.insert(assignment.conditionToAssignTo);
for(const string &cs : assignment.expressionToEvaluate.RelevantConditions())
result.insert(cs);
}
return result;
}
void ConditionAssignments::AddSetCondition(const std::string &name, const ConditionsStore *conditions)
{
this->conditions = conditions;
assignments.emplace_back(name, AssignOp::ASSIGN, ConditionSet(1, conditions));
}
void ConditionAssignments::Add(const DataNode &node, const ConditionsStore *conditions)
{
this->conditions = conditions;
const string &key = node.Token(0);
if(key == "set" || key == "clear")
{
if(node.Size() != 2 || !DataNode::IsConditionName(node.Token(1)))
{
node.PrintTrace("Parse error; " + key + " keyword requires a single valid condition:");
return;
}
assignments.emplace_back(node.Token(1), AssignOp::ASSIGN,
ConditionSet(key == "set" ? 1 : 0, conditions));
}
else if(node.Size() == 2 && (node.Token(1) == "++" || node.Token(1) == "--"))
{
if(!DataNode::IsConditionName(key))
{
node.PrintTrace("Parse error; " + node.Token(1) + " operator requires a single valid condition:");
return;
}
assignments.emplace_back(key, node.Token(1) == "++" ? AssignOp::ADD : AssignOp::SUB,
ConditionSet(1, conditions));
}
else if(node.Size() >= 3)
{
// Parse the assignment operator.
AssignOp ao = AssignOp::ASSIGN;
const string assignOpString = node.Token(1);
auto it = find_if(ASSIGN_OP_TO_TEXT.begin(), ASSIGN_OP_TO_TEXT.end(),
[&assignOpString](const std::pair<AssignOp, const string> &e) {
return e.second == assignOpString;
});
if(it != ASSIGN_OP_TO_TEXT.end())
ao = it->first;
else
{
node.PrintTrace("Parse error; Unsupported assignment operator (" + assignOpString + "):");
return;
}
// Parse the expression.
ConditionSet expr(conditions);
int tokenNr = 2;
if(!expr.ParseNode(node, tokenNr))
return;
// Perform optimization of the parsed expression.
expr.Optimize(node);
// Add the assignment when all parsing succeeded.
assignments.emplace_back(key, ao, expr);
}
else
{
node.PrintTrace("Error: Incomplete assignment");
return;
}
}
ConditionAssignments::Assignment::Assignment(string conditionToAssignTo, AssignOp assignOperator,
ConditionSet expressionToEvaluate) : conditionToAssignTo(conditionToAssignTo), assignOperator(assignOperator),
expressionToEvaluate(expressionToEvaluate)
{
}
